npm vs Nginx
A comprehensive head-to-head comparison of two leading web development solutions in 2026. Compare features, pricing, ratings, and more to find the right fit.
Quick Verdict
Choose npm if you need Package installation and prefer a free starting option. Choose Nginx if you prioritize High-performance web server and want a free tier to start. Nginx has a higher user rating (4.5 vs 4.4).
npm vs Nginx: At a Glance
Feature Comparison: npm vs Nginx
| Feature | npm | Nginx |
|---|---|---|
| Package installation | ||
| Dependency management | ||
| Version management | ||
| Script running | ||
| Package publishing | ||
| Security auditing | ||
| Package discovery | ||
| CLI interface | ||
| Node.js | ||
| GitHub | ||
| Visual Studio Code | ||
| WebStorm | ||
| CI/CD systems | ||
| Docker | ||
| Webpack | ||
| High-performance web server | ||
| Reverse proxy | ||
| Load balancing | ||
| HTTP caching | ||
| SSL/TLS termination | ||
| Gzip compression | ||
| Rate limiting | ||
| Static file serving | ||
| Kubernetes | ||
| Let's Encrypt | ||
| Cloudflare | ||
| AWS | ||
| PHP-FPM | ||
| uWSGI |
npm vs Nginx: Pricing Breakdown
npm Pricing
Model: freemium
- Unlimited public packages
- Package discovery
- npm CLI
- Community support
- Unlimited private packages
- Package analytics
- Support
- Advanced security
- Team management
- Organization packages
- Audit logs
- Security scanning
Nginx Pricing
Model: freemium
- Web server
- Reverse proxy
- Load balancing
- SSL termination
- Advanced load balancing
- Application health checks
- Dynamic configuration
- Enhanced monitoring
Pros and Cons
npm
Pros
- Highly rated by users (4.4/5)
- Free plan available to get started
- Available on 3 platforms (Windows, Macos, Linux)
- Rich feature set with 15+ capabilities
- Strong Package installation functionality
- Strong Dependency management functionality
Cons
- May require time to learn advanced features
Nginx
Pros
- Highly rated by users (4.5/5)
- Free plan available to get started
- Available on 4 platforms (Linux, Windows, Macos, Freebsd)
- Rich feature set with 15+ capabilities
- Strong High-performance web server functionality
- Strong Reverse proxy functionality
Cons
- May require time to learn advanced features
Who Should Use npm vs Nginx?
Choose npm if you:
- Need Package installation
- Want to start for free
- Work primarily on Windows and Macos
- Value Dependency management
Choose Nginx if you:
- Need High-performance web server
- Want to start for free
- Work primarily on Linux and Windows
- Value Reverse proxy
Frequently Asked Questions: npm vs Nginx
Is npm better than Nginx?
It depends on your needs. npm has a 4.4/5 user rating while Nginx has 4.5/5. npm excels in Package installation and Dependency management, while Nginx stands out with High-performance web server and Reverse proxy. Consider your budget (Free vs Free), platform needs, and specific feature requirements.
Which is cheaper, npm or Nginx?
npm offers a free plan and starts at Free. Nginx offers a free plan and starts at Free. Compare the specific plan features to determine the best value for your use case.
Can I use npm and Nginx together?
While both are web development tools, some teams use complementary software together. Check each product's API and integration capabilities for compatibility. However, most users find that one solution covers their core web development needs.
What are the main differences between npm and Nginx?
The key differences include: pricing model (freemium vs freemium), platform support (Windows, Macos, Linux vs Linux, Windows, Macos, Freebsd), and feature focus. npm emphasizes Package installation, Dependency management, Version management while Nginx focuses on High-performance web server, Reverse proxy, Load balancing. User ratings differ slightly: 4.4 vs 4.5 out of 5.
Ready to choose?
Explore detailed reviews, user ratings, and pricing for both npm and Nginx.